Gunung Tungku
Gunung Tungku is a peak in Jerantut, Pahang and has an elevation of 928 metres. Gunung Tungku is situated nearby to the village Kampung Perlok, as well as near the hamlet Kampung Lata.- Type: Peak with an elevation of 928 metres
- Description: mountain in Pahang, Malaysia
- Also known as: “Bukit Tungku”
